This U.S. State Privacy Rights Addendum supplements the Privacy Notice of SnotStore.com (“Snot Store,” “we,” “our,” or “us”) and applies to residents of U.S. states that have enacted comprehensive consumer privacy laws.

Depending on your state of residence, you may have the following rights regarding your personal information.

1. States Covered by This Addendum

This Addendum applies to residents of states with active consumer privacy laws, including but not limited to:

  • California (CCPA/CPRA)

  • Virginia (VCDPA)

  • Colorado (CPA)

  • Connecticut (CTDPA)

  • Utah (UCPA)

  • Texas (TDPSA)

  • Oregon (OCPA)

  • Montana (MCDPA)

  • Delaware (DPDPA)

  • Iowa (ICDPA)

  • Indiana (ICDPA)

  • Tennessee (TIPA)

  • New Jersey (NJDPA)

  • New Hampshire (NHPA)

  • Nebraska (NDPA)

If your state enacts a similar law, this Addendum will apply to you when required.

2. Your Privacy Rights

Subject to verification and applicable legal exceptions, you may have the right to:

A. Right to Know / Access

Request confirmation of whether we process your personal information and obtain a copy of the data we hold about you.

B. Right to Correct

Request correction of inaccurate personal information.

C. Right to Delete

Request deletion of personal information we have collected about you.

D. Right to Data Portability

Receive your personal information in a portable and readily usable format.

E. Right to Opt-Out

Depending on your state, you may have the right to opt out of:

  • The sale of personal information

  • Targeted advertising

  • Profiling in furtherance of decisions that produce legal or similarly significant effects
